A Prime Number

A prime number is a positive integer that is divisible only by itself and one.

Four thousand and ninety-one is the 563rd prime number.   See primes in Base 21 Unovigesimal

Not A Composite

Composites have more than just these two factors.

Four Thousand and Ninety-One is not a composite number because it has exactly two factors: One and Four Thousand and Ninety-One
